Oregon Statutes - Chapter 479 - Protection of Buildings From Fire; Electrical Safety Law - Section 479.632 - Applicant training or experience obtained in another state.

Notwithstanding any other provision of ORS 479.510 to 479.945 or any rule adopted by the Electrical and Elevator Board under ORS 455.117, the board may not administer an examination to, and the Department of Consumer and Business Services may not issue any license to, a person whose practical experience qualification for the license is based upon training or experience in another state if the board determines that the training or experience is not equivalent to the standards for electrical training programs prescribed in this state. [2005 c.758 §31]
